"It's not so easy to give away money if you want to do it smart, if you want to be intelligent about it." - Howard Buffett reflects on the complexities of philanthropy.
"Wealthy people don't tend to give their money to other people to give away," said James Ferris, highlighting the common hesitance among the rich to delegate philanthropy.
"It shows how a donor is making choices and is adapting to circumstances," indicating Buffett's evolving approach to philanthropy as a positive narrative.
Warren Buffett has provided $43 billion to the Gates Foundation since 2006, illustrating his commitment to impactful giving before passing the reins to his children.
